## Escalation: Firmware Update Channel (Orvex Devices)

If the stable channel serves a build that fails signature checks, pause the channel immediately via the Larkwood console and note the build hash in the release log. Do not roll back without approval from the firmware duty lead. Escalations outside the rotation window go to the channel owners at the following address.

alerts address for kajog-tadup: druox@plorvanet.internal

## Releases

ShelfStream publishes catalogue-import builds monthly. Plugin authors must target the import schema pinned in each release tag; MARC-variant mappings change between minors, so re-run the Stackwise conformance suite before publishing. Unsigned plugin bundles are rejected by the registry. All official ShelfStream artifacts are signed; verify downloads before building against them using the key below.

release key, yafof-kadup: bky4_soBk

## Deployment

The Pickwright optimizer deploys via the standard Harbinger pipeline to the Ordway warehouse cluster. Deploys are blue-green; the new instance must pass a synthetic pick-list run before traffic shifts. If rollback is needed, re-point the router — do not redeploy the old build. Configuration is read once at startup, so changes require a restart. The live configuration for the current release is listed below.

settings of fafog-haduf:
ZORIX_PIN=4648
ZORIX_METRICS_HOST=metrics.zorix.paliqsys.corp
ZORIX_LOG_LEVEL=info
ZORIX_TENANT=druix

### Step 4: Deploying Addrly

Before the address autocomplete widget goes live, the bundle gets signed so the CDN can verify it. Heads up for review: the signing step runs in CI only, never on laptops, and the key rotates monthly. Everything's audited in the pipeline logs. Current signing key follows.

rollout seal: bky9_PeXH1fTLY

TURN-208: Gatevale turnstile counters at the Merrow Field pilot double-count when a rotation reverses mid-cycle. Attendance totals drift roughly 2% high per event. The debounce window fix is implemented, reviewed by Ilsa, and soak-tested across two simulated match days without drift. Ready for your cut; the candidate build is identified below.

trace token, tagag-tafog: htk6_5ed18c